Cisco Secure Email Add-Ins No Longer Supported on Microsoft Outlook 2019

This is to inform you that, effective October 14, 2025, Microsoft Outlook 2019 is no longer supported for the Secure Email Encryption Service Add-In and Secure Email Submission Add-In.

To continue using these Add-Ins, we recommend upgrading to Microsoft 365. Starting October 2025, download and install the new manifest for:

- Secure Email Encryption Service Add-In from the CRES Admin Dashboard

- Secure Email Submission Add-In from the Cisco Software Download Portal

After downloading the manifests, follow the instructions provided in the Submission and Encryption Add-In guides. For more information, see: Cisco Email Encryption - End-User Guides.

TLS 1.0/1.1 Deprecation from AsyncOS for Secure Email Gateway, Starting version 16.5

We would like to inform you that starting with the AsyncOS 16.5 release, TLS versions 1.0 and 1.1 will no longer be available as configuration options in both the CLI and GUI.

To ensure secure email delivery and receipt, you should use TLS versions 1.2 and 1.3. These versions can be configured via the sslconfig CLI command or through the System Administration > SSL Configuration menu in the user interface.

For detailed instructions on updating TLS versions, please refer to the “System Administration” section of the User Guide for AsyncOS 16.0.x for Cisco Secure Email Gateway.
